Core Insights - The article highlights the transformative role of thermoplastic composites in the automotive manufacturing landscape, particularly in the context of the electric vehicle (EV) industry, emphasizing their advantages in lightweighting, recyclability, and safety performance [1][9]. Industry Overview - Thermoplastic composites are defined as composite materials made from thermoplastic polymers reinforced with various fibers, such as carbon and glass fibers, specifically applied in the EV sector [3]. - The market size for China's thermoplastic composites in the EV sector is projected to reach 13.4 billion yuan in 2024, with a year-on-year growth of 13.4%, and is expected to grow to 16.7 billion yuan by 2025 [1][9]. Industry Policies - Recent policies, such as the Shanghai government's action plan for high-quality development in low-altitude economy, emphasize the integration of advanced materials like thermoplastic composites into strategic development [4]. - The Ministry of Industry and Information Technology's plan for the construction materials industry supports the application of composite materials in various sectors, including automotive [5]. Industry Value Chain - The thermoplastic composites industry in China has established a complete value chain, from raw material supply (fibers and resins) to manufacturing and final application in EVs [6]. - Carbon fiber, a key reinforcement material, significantly enhances the mechanical properties and lightweight characteristics of composites, contributing to the performance of EV components [6]. Market Trends - The global market for thermoplastic composites in the EV sector is expected to grow from 52.11 million tons in 2024 to 58.28 million tons in 2025, and further to 94.35 million tons by 2030 [8][9]. - The rapid growth in EV production and sales in China, from 340,500 units in 2015 to 12.89 million units in 2024, drives the demand for thermoplastic composites [6]. Competitive Landscape - The industry features a mix of international leaders like DuPont and domestic players such as Kingfa Technology and Nanjing Julong, creating a diverse competitive environment [10]. - Kingfa Technology reported a revenue of 31.64 billion yuan in the first half of 2025,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 35.5% [11]. Future Development Trends - Innovations in material systems are anticipated, including the development of self-healing and shape-memory thermoplastic composites, enhancing safety and longevity [12]. - The integration of digital and biological manufacturing technologies is expected to revolutionize production processes, leading to intelligent upgrades in composite manufacturing [14]. - A new circular economy model is being proposed, focusing on programmable degradation materials and blockchain technology for material traceability, aligning with the environmental goals of the EV industry [15].

Core Viewpoint - Daosheng Tianhe, a leading global manufacturer of epoxy resin for wind turbine blades, successfully went public on the Shanghai Stock Exchange, marking a new chapter in its growth amid the "dual carbon" strategy [2] Company Overview - Established in 2015 and headquartered in the Shanghai Free Trade Zone, Daosheng Tianhe is a national high-tech enterprise focused on the R&D, production, and sales of new materials [2] - The company specializes in high-performance thermosetting resin materials, including epoxy resin, polyurethane, acrylic, and organic silicon, with products serving the wind power, new energy vehicles, energy storage, hydrogen energy, and other sectors [2] Market Position and Performance - Daosheng Tianhe is recognized as a "hidden champion" in the domestic market and has demonstrated strong capabilities in global competition [3] - The company has achieved full coverage of mainstream wind turbine blade designs with its epoxy resin products, projecting sales of 143,100 tons for 2024 in this category, making it the global leader [3] - In the new energy vehicle adhesive sector, Daosheng Tianhe has successfully entered the supply chains of major automakers and battery manufacturers, showcasing strong customer loyalty and market expansion potential [3] Industry Growth Potential - The global energy transition and electric vehicle trends are driving high growth in Daosheng Tianhe's market segments [4] - The Global Wind Energy Council forecasts a compound annual growth rate of 9.4% for new wind power installations from 2024 to 2028, with China planning to add over 50 GW annually during the 14th Five-Year Plan [4] - The penetration rate of new energy vehicles in China has surpassed 40%, leading to a surge in demand for adhesives and lightweight composite materials [4] Financial Performance - Daosheng Tianhe has shown steady financial performance, with revenues of 3.202 billion yuan, 3.238 billion yuan, and 835 million yuan for 2023, 2024 Q1, and 2025 Q1 respectively, alongside net profits of 155 million yuan, 155 million yuan, and 31.08 million yuan [4] - The company anticipates a year-on-year revenue growth of 22.32% to 27.03% and a net profit growth of 48.21% to 58.43% for the first three quarters of 2025, indicating strong profitability and growth potential [4] IPO and Future Plans - The IPO raised funds to support the annual production of 56,000 tons of high-end adhesives for new energy and power batteries, as well as high-performance composite resin systems, which will enhance the company's capacity and competitiveness in these sectors [4]
